Taylor Swift’s tour tickets crashed TicketMaster. The crash began at around 10 a.m. on Tuesday, November 15, 2022.

Within minutes of Swift’s release, hundreds of thousands of tickets were sold. Many people get to the payment stage of the transaction and then are kicked out. 

However, many of her listeners were very upset at the “crash” of the website. 

The crash caused ticket prices to soar for people willing to sell them on different platforms. One ticket sold for $22,000 instead of the starting price of $49 per ticket.
